ZTE Security’s Dedication to Excellence
When verifying IT goods’ safety, the Common Criteria seal of approval is universally acknowledged as the gold standard. The ZXONE 9700, ZXMP M721 and ZXONE 7000 series are all OTN devices manufactured by ZTE that now hold the Common Criteria CC EAL3+ certification.
The CC EAL3+ certification offers an internationally recognized standard by which items receive certification after proving they have met all applicable safety standards. ZTE Security’s Rigorous Evaluation Process
ZTE’s optical networking equipment has the stamp of approval from the Dutch government when it comes to safety. The National Communications Security Agency (NSICB) in the Netherlands uses a thorough review procedure to determine the safety and reliability of information and communication technology (ICT) goods. Protecting private information and national security interests requires a thorough evaluation like this one.
Organizations that conduct impartial audits, play a vital role in the certification process. Certifications and professional assistance from organizations like TüV Rheinland Nederland and SGS Brightsight help consumers feel confident in the security of their ICT purchases. Their assessments are essential to ensuring the security and integrity of critical infrastructure in the Netherlands and the prevention of emerging forms of cybercrime.
TüV Rheinland Nederland’s testing and certification services are well known for their dependability in ensuring that products adhere to all relevant safety regulations. Cryptographic methods, safe protocols and protection from typical cyberattacks are just some of the things they test.
SGS Brightsight is another internationally acclaimed security testing facility. They analyze the security of ICT goods in terms of their resistance to exploits and other threats. This includes looking at the product’s security architecture, reading through the code and doing penetration tests.
